AnnouncementHouston City College announces $17 million investment from Bloomberg Philanthropies to expand skilled trades, apprenticeships regionally
Houston City College (HCC) announced the launch of Gulf Coast TradeUp Careers, a regional workforce transformation initiative supported by a $17 million investment from Bloomberg Philanthropies. The initiative is part of a new $90 million national effort from Bloomberg Philanthropies to change how high school students prepare for and enter Registered Apprenticeships and high-wage, family-sustaining careers in the skilled trades.

Student SpotlightLearning the language of inclusion: HCC American Sign Language students champion Deaf awareness
On a Sunday afternoon, when the restaurant is typically closed, the Chick-fil-A in Deer Park opened its doors to students from the HCC Interpreting Training/American Sign Language (ASL) program. Ten student members of the ASL Honor Society were there to teach the language of inclusion—showing hearing employees how to communicate with their four Deaf co-workers. For the HCC students, it was community service, professional training and something far more personal all at once.

HCC S.O.A.R. program aims to accelerate local business growth
This summer, Houston City College is launching S.O.A.R., a new 10‑week, AI‑powered accelerator designed to help early‑stage businesses grow faster, operate smarter, and compete in a rapidly changing marketplace. The program—hosted at the HCC Central Campus Center for Entrepreneurship—is set to start next month. It is seeking participants from across Houston, Pearland and surrounding communities.

Houston City College announces $2 million in funding from Google to expand AI training across region
Houston City College (HCC) has received $2 million in funding from Google.org, Google’s philanthropic arm, to expand artificial intelligence programs, train more instructors and boost the greater Houston region’s pipeline of students entering fast-growing AI and robotics careers.
